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

Aggiornamento campi collegati.

1,155 views
Skip to first unread message

paoloard

unread,
Jan 30, 2010, 4:12:39 AM1/30/10
to
Buongiorno a tutti, nei miei interventi circa l'oggetto ho sempre sostenuto,
senza peraltro essere smentito, che Word non effettuava l'aggiornamento
automatico di campi testo collegati con altri dovendo intervenire con il
tasto F9 per il loro ricalcolo.
Invece, in questo articolo http://www.maproject.it/problema_office.html si
sostiene, e con ragione, che ci� � possibile.
La tecnica � anche molto semplice e si pu� spiegare con un esempio
semplificato: occorre innanzitutto creare un modello di documento e salvarlo
come tale. Supponiamo di avere il campo testo Cognome che deve essere
ripetutto uguale in altra parte del modello. Si creano i due campi testo,
poi si seleziona il primo campo, quello nel quale si deve scrivere il dato
che verr� replicato nel secondo campo, tasto destro-->propriet�. Nella
finestra che si apre si noti che di finaco a "Segnalibro" vi � gi� un nome
di default. Se si vuole si pu� cambiare, per es.in Cognome. Sempre nella
stessa attivare la scelta "Calcola in uscita".
Fatto questo spostarsi sul secondo campo, quello che si deve aggiornare in
automatico, e inserire un riferimento incrociato al segnalibro Cognome.
Fatto questo proteggere il modello.
A questo punto si noter� che premendo "tab" dopo l'inserimento di un testo
nel primo campo il secondo si aggiorner� in automatico.
Ho postato l'argomento come domanda perch� in effetti vorrei porre una
domanda:
se volessi che il secondo campo si aggiornasse in subordine a differenti
scelte da porre nel primo campo come potrei intervenire sul secondo.
Pi� precisamente vorrei che nel secondo campo comparisse il testo Celibe
quando nel primo campo inserisco la C, oppure Nubile inserendo la N ecc...
Grazie per l'attenzione.
Ciao Giovanni, come stai? ;-)

--
ciao paoloard
http://riolab.org

Giovanni Zezza

unread,
Jan 30, 2010, 3:03:12 PM1/30/10
to
paoloard, nel messaggio
<ADB35D8E-62A7-4496...@microsoft.com>, scriveva:

>se volessi che il secondo campo si aggiornasse in subordine a differenti
>scelte da porre nel primo campo come potrei intervenire sul secondo.
>Pi� precisamente vorrei che nel secondo campo comparisse il testo Celibe
>quando nel primo campo inserisco la C, oppure Nubile inserendo la N ecc...

Come al solito, io se volessi fare qualcosa del genere sceglierei uno
strumento diverso da Word.

Tra l'altro, non sono sicuro di aver capito bene la "ricetta"
dell'articolo. In particolare, non mi � chiaro perch� sia necessario
creare un modello per fare un modulo; e ancor meno come possa un campo
essere contemporaneamente un campo modulo e un campo riferimento: mi
pare che, nel momento in cui lo si definisce come riferimento
incrociato, venga eliminato il campo modulo precedentemente definito
in quel punto.

A parte queste perplessit�, comunque, l'unico modo che vedo per
realizzare quello che chiedi e associare il primo campo modulo ad una
macro in uscita, che modifichi "qualcosa" nel documento (direttamente
il valore del secondo campo, o un segnalibro o altro). Si inverte
cio�, in un certo senso, il processo: non � il secondo campo a fare
riferimento al primo, ma l'ExitMacro del primo a modificare
esplicitamente il secondo.

La macro, naturalmente, pu� a questo punto fare qualunque cosa in
corrispondenza del valore inserito nel primo campo: scorrere un array,
consultare un database...

Ciao.

paoloard

unread,
Feb 6, 2010, 5:30:04 AM2/6/10
to
On 30 Gen, 21:03, Giovanni Zezza <zezza...@tin.it> wrote:
> paoloard, nel messaggio
> <ADB35D8E-62A7-4496-AD63-5BC21D0B0...@microsoft.com>, scriveva:

Ciao Giovanni grazie per la risposta che leggo solo oggi. Purtroppo
non avevo visto l'aggiornamento dal mio client (sembra che i server
ultimamente stiano facendo i capricci).
Prendo nota di quello che mi dici sulla cui base farò i necessari
approfondimenti.
Grazie ancora
paoloard

paoloard

unread,
Feb 7, 2010, 6:04:06 AM2/7/10
to
On 30 Gen, 21:03, Giovanni Zezza <zezza...@tin.it> wrote:
> paoloard, nel messaggio
> <ADB35D8E-62A7-4496-AD63-5BC21D0B0...@microsoft.com>, scriveva:
>
> Come al solito, io se volessi fare qualcosa del genere sceglierei uno
> strumento diverso da Word.

il tuo pensiero è noto :-)

>
> Tra l'altro, non sono sicuro di aver capito bene la "ricetta"
> dell'articolo. In particolare, non mi chiaro perch sia necessario
> creare un modello per fare un modulo; e ancor meno come possa un campo
> essere contemporaneamente un campo modulo e un campo riferimento: mi
> pare che, nel momento in cui lo si definisce come riferimento
> incrociato, venga eliminato il campo modulo precedentemente definito
> in quel punto.

sì, ho rivisto la procedura, hai ragione

> A parte queste perplessit , comunque, l'unico modo che vedo per
> realizzare quello che chiedi e associare il primo campo modulo ad una
> macro in uscita, che modifichi "qualcosa" nel documento (direttamente
> il valore del secondo campo, o un segnalibro o altro). Si inverte
> cio , in un certo senso, il processo: non il secondo campo a fare
> riferimento al primo, ma l'ExitMacro del primo a modificare
> esplicitamente il secondo.
>
> La macro, naturalmente, pu a questo punto fare qualunque cosa in
> corrispondenza del valore inserito nel primo campo: scorrere un array,
> consultare un database...
>
> Ciao.

ciao paoloard

paoloard

unread,
Feb 10, 2010, 3:06:17 AM2/10/10
to

Ciao Giovanni, se ci sei ancora prova a vedere questa soluzione e
dimmi cosa ne pensi. Secondo me dovrebbe essere risolutiva del
problema. http://social.microsoft.com/Forums/it-IT/wordit/thread/27c75eb3-5c39-40a8-b0b2-8f872c2c58a2
Ciao paoloard
http://riolab.org

0 new messages